History of Roulette

The origins of roulette can be traced back to 18th-century France. The name “roulette” means “little wheel” in French, and the game was designed as a gambling game for the French aristocracy. It wasn’t until the 19th century that roulette spread to casinos in Europe and the Americas. Today, it remains a staple in casinos around the globe, with slight variations in rules depending on the version of the game.

Types of Roulette

There are several different variations of roulette, each with its own unique set of rules. The most common types are:

  • European Roulette: Features a single zero (0) on the wheel, which gives the house a lower edge compared to American roulette.
  • American Roulette: Includes both a single zero (0) and a double zero (00), increasing the house edge and making it slightly less favorable for players.
  • French Roulette: Similar to European roulette but with additional rules like “La Partage” that can provide better odds.

Understanding the Basics

Playing roulette is relatively straightforward. The game consists of a spinning wheel and a betting table. Players can place bets on individual numbers, groups of numbers, or even colors. The dealer spins the wheel in one direction and rolls a small ball in the opposite direction. When the ball comes to rest in one of the numbered slots, bets are settled based on where the ball lands.

How to Place Bets

There are two main types of bets in roulette: inside and outside bets.

Inside Bets

Inside bets are placed on specific numbers or small groups of numbers. These bets tend to have higher payouts but lower odds of winning. Some types of inside bets include:

  • Straight Bet: Wagering on a single number.
  • Split Bet: Wagering on two adjacent numbers.
  • Street Bet: Wagering on three numbers in a horizontal line.

Outside bets are placed on larger groups of numbers or colors and have better odds of winning, albeit at lower payouts. Some common outside bets include:

  • Red or Black: Betting on either color.
  • Odd or Even: Betting on whether the winning number will be odd or even.
  • Low or High: Betting on low numbers (1-18) or high numbers (19-36).

Strategies for Winning

While roulette is primarily a game of chance, some strategies can help you maximize your profits and minimize losses. Here are a few popular approaches:

The Martingale System

This is one of the most famous betting systems for roulette. The idea is simple: you double your bet after every loss. When you finally win, the goal is to recover all previous losses plus gain a profit equal to your original stake. However, this strategy requires a significant bankroll and may not work in the long run due to table limits.

The Fibonacci System

Based on the famous Fibonacci sequence, this strategy involves betting by adding the two previous bets together to determine the next bet amount. While less aggressive than the Martingale, it can also lead to larger losses if you’re not careful.

The D’Alembert System

This strategy entails raising your bet by one unit after a loss and lowering it by one unit after a win. It’s a more gradual approach that can be easier on your bankroll but still carries the risk of significant losses.
